Abstract

The present disclosure makes a grating assisted optical waveguide device. The method includes cleaning a substrate made of glass by means of cleaning agents; depositing a first layer made of metal onto a surface of the substrate by an evaporation process; forming a first mask by making openings in the first layer to expose first parts of the surface, the first mask being formed by a photolithographic process; immersing the substrate in a first bath of molten salt having a first preselected temperature to make a waveguide by increasing the refractive index of the glass in the first parts by an ion-exchange process; removing the first mask from the surface; immersing the substrate in a second bath of molten salt in order to bury the waveguide; depositing a second layer made of metal on the surface of the substrate by an evaporation process; forming a second mask by making openings in the second layer to expose second parts of the surface, the second mask being formed by a photolithographic process; immersing the substrate in a third bath of molten salt having a third preselected temperature to change the refractive index of the glass in the second parts by an ion-exchange process in …
